One of the first bags I sewed was a carrying case for a Leapster handheld gaming thing. I've definitely come a long way since then! And there are so many cool patterns available for just about any specific system.  The Stardew gaming carrier can hold a bunch of different gaming systems, but it really fits the Nintendo Switch the best!

I have a ton of gaming fabrics, but the first order I got for this pattern was in an adorable princess fabric! The papercut princesses from Hapa Fabric is so bright and detailed!
I tried to get as many princesses as I could on there!

The request was for Belle to be the focus, so obviously I needed to use rose zipper pulls from Wizardry, Stitchery, and Crafts!  Rainbow hardware, rivets and zipper coordinated well with the fabric since it is so colorful.

The handles are made with a blue glitter vinyl, which matches the blue (not vinyl) bias binding inside. I really don't like doing bias binding, mainly because I end up hand sewing it to make it look better. I haven't figured out the trick to doing neat machine sewn on bias tape yet...

The inside fabric is a gorgeous licensed Beauty and the Beast toss print, the red on red print has so many fun details, but they don't show up that well in pictures.  There is a large pocket that holds a regular sized Switch, plus pockets on the other side to hold the (tiny) game cartridges!

I need to think about how to make this pattern without binding, it would probably go a little faster for me!  There are different strap and handle options, and I'd love to try one with the reverse appliques or something fancy!
